How to Choose the Right Commercial Electric Fryer for Your Fast Food Business

Choosing the right commercial electric fryer directly affects your store efficiency, food quality and operating cost.
First, match the fryer to your business size:
  • Small shops, kiosks and food trucks: countertop fryers (220V, 4.5KW–9KW)
  • Standard fast‑food stores: floor‑standing dual‑tank fryers
  • High‑volume chains: multi‑tank fryers with filter and auto‑lift

Second, focus on these core features:
  • Precise temperature control (±1℃) keeps food crispy and consistent
  • Built‑in oil filter system saves 30%–50% on oil costs
  • Auto‑lift function prevents overcooking and improves safety
  • Food‑grade 304 stainless steel ensures durability and hygiene
Third, always select CE, FCC and ISO certified fryers for stable daily use and global export.

Commercial Electric Fryer vs Home Fryer – Why You Need a Professional Model

Many new restaurant owners ask: Can I use a home fryer for business?
The short answer: No.
Commercial electric fryers are built for 12–16 hours of daily heavy use:
  • Higher power (4.5KW–36KW) for fast and stable heating
  • Professional temperature control for consistent food quality
  • Full safety protection: overheat, dry‑burn, anti‑scald and leakage protection
  • Food‑grade 304 stainless steel for food safety and long service life
  • Large oil tanks and high output for busy restaurants

Home fryers overheat quickly, break down easily and cannot meet commercial hygiene and efficiency standards.
If you run a restaurant, franchise or chain store, always choose a commercial‑grade electric fryer.
